• folder
  • folder
  • save
  • close
  • search
  • more_vert
  • save
  • close
  • search
  • more_vert
  • New tab
  • Components
  • Material Icons
  • Editor Settings
  • Network status
  • About HASS-Configurator
  • Observe events
  • Reload automations
  • Reload scripts
  • Reload groups
  • Reload core
  • Restart HASS
  • Execute shell command
  • New tab
  • Help
  • Components
  • Material Icons
  • Editor Settings
  • Network status
  • About HASS-Configurator
  • Observe events
  • Reload automations
  • Reload scripts
  • Reload groups
  • Reload core
  • Restart HASS
  • Execute shell command
  • git init
  • git commit
  • git push
  • git init
  • git commit
  • git push

Ace Keyboard Shortcuts


  • view_headlineLine Operations
    Windows/Linux Mac Action
    Ctrl-D Command-D Remove line
    Alt-Shift-Down Command-Option-Down Copy lines down
    Alt-Shift-Up Command-Option-Up Copy lines up
    Alt-Down Option-Down Move lines down
    Alt-Up Option-Up Move lines up
    Alt-Delete Ctrl-K Remove to line end
    Alt-Backspace Command-Backspace Remove to linestart
    Ctrl-Backspace Option-Backspace, Ctrl-Option-Backspace Remove word left
    Ctrl-Delete Option-Delete Remove word right
    --- Ctrl-O Split line
  • photo_size_select_smallSelection
    Windows/Linux Mac Action
    Ctrl-A Command-A Select all
    Shift-Left Shift-Left Select left
    Shift-Right Shift-Right Select right
    Ctrl-Shift-Left Option-Shift-Left Select word left
    Ctrl-Shift-Right Option-Shift-Right Select word right
    Shift-Home Shift-Home Select line start
    Shift-End Shift-End Select line end
    Alt-Shift-Right Command-Shift-Right Select to line end
    Alt-Shift-Left Command-Shift-Left Select to line start
    Shift-Up Shift-Up Select up
    Shift-Down Shift-Down Select down
    Shift-PageUp Shift-PageUp Select page up
    Shift-PageDown Shift-PageDown Select page down
    Ctrl-Shift-Home Command-Shift-Up Select to start
    Ctrl-Shift-End Command-Shift-Down Select to end
    Ctrl-Shift-D Command-Shift-D Duplicate selection
    Ctrl-Shift-P --- Select to matching bracket
  • multiline_chartMulticursor
    Windows/Linux Mac Action
    Ctrl-Alt-Up Ctrl-Option-Up Add multi-cursor above
    Ctrl-Alt-Down Ctrl-Option-Down Add multi-cursor below
    Ctrl-Alt-Right Ctrl-Option-Right Add next occurrence to multi-selection
    Ctrl-Alt-Left Ctrl-Option-Left Add previous occurrence to multi-selection
    Ctrl-Alt-Shift-Up Ctrl-Option-Shift-Up Move multicursor from current line to the line above
    Ctrl-Alt-Shift-Down Ctrl-Option-Shift-Down Move multicursor from current line to the line below
    Ctrl-Alt-Shift-Right Ctrl-Option-Shift-Right Remove current occurrence from multi-selection and move to next
    Ctrl-Alt-Shift-Left Ctrl-Option-Shift-Left Remove current occurrence from multi-selection and move to previous
    Ctrl-Shift-L Ctrl-Shift-L Select all from multi-selection
  • call_missed_outgoingGo To
    Windows/Linux Mac Action
    Left Left, Ctrl-B Go to left
    Right Right, Ctrl-F Go to right
    Ctrl-Left Option-Left Go to word left
    Ctrl-Right Option-Right Go to word right
    Up Up, Ctrl-P Go line up
    Down Down, Ctrl-N Go line down
    Alt-Left, Home Command-Left, Home, Ctrl-A Go to line start
    Alt-Right, End Command-Right, End, Ctrl-E Go to line end
    PageUp Option-PageUp Go to page up
    PageDown Option-PageDown, Ctrl-V Go to page down
    Ctrl-Home Command-Home, Command-Up Go to start
    Ctrl-End Command-End, Command-Down Go to end
    Ctrl-L Command-L Go to line
    Ctrl-Down Command-Down Scroll line down
    Ctrl-Up --- Scroll line up
    Ctrl-P --- Go to matching bracket
    --- Option-PageDown Scroll page down
    --- Option-PageUp Scroll page up
  • find_replaceFind/Replace
    Windows/Linux Mac Action
    Ctrl-F Command-F Find
    Ctrl-H Command-Option-F Replace
    Ctrl-K Command-G Find next
    Ctrl-Shift-K Command-Shift-G Find previous
  • all_outFolding
    Windows/Linux Mac Action
    Alt-L, Ctrl-F1 Command-Option-L, Command-F1 Fold selection
    Alt-Shift-L, Ctrl-Shift-F1 Command-Option-Shift-L, Command-Shift-F1 Unfold
    Alt-0 Command-Option-0 Fold all
    Alt-Shift-0 Command-Option-Shift-0 Unfold all
  • devices_otherOther
    Windows/Linux Mac Action
    Tab Tab Indent
    Shift-Tab Shift-Tab Outdent
    Ctrl-Z Command-Z Undo
    Ctrl-Shift-Z, Ctrl-Y Command-Shift-Z, Command-Y Redo
    Ctrl-, Command-, Show the settings menu
    Ctrl-/ Command-/ Toggle comment
    Ctrl-T Ctrl-T Transpose letters
    Ctrl-Enter Command-Enter Enter full screen
    Ctrl-Shift-U Ctrl-Shift-U Change to lower case
    Ctrl-U Ctrl-U Change to upper case
    Insert Insert Overwrite
    Ctrl-Shift-E Command-Shift-E Macros replay
    Ctrl-Alt-E --- Macros recording
    Delete --- Delete
    --- Ctrl-L Center selection
Close

Event Observererror_outline


Connect Disconnect Close

Savesave

Do you really want to save?

No Yes

Upload Filefile_upload

Please choose a file to upload

File
Cancel OK

git init

Are you sure you want to initialize a repository at the current path?

Cancel OK

git commit

Cancel OK

git push

Are you sure you want to push your commited changes to the configured remote / origin?

Cancel OK

Close Fileclose

Are you sure you want to close the current file? Unsaved changes will be lost.

No Yes

Delete

Are you sure you want to delete ?

No Yes

git add

Are you sure you want to add to the index?

No Yes

Check configuration

Do you want to check the configuration?

No Yes

Reload automations

Do you want to reload the automations?

No Yes

Reload scripts

Do you want to reload the scripts?

No Yes

Reload groups

Do you want to reload the groups?

No Yes

Reload core

Do you want to reload the core?

No Yes

Restart

Do you really want to restart Home Assistant?

No Yes

Remove allowed network / IP

Do you really want to remove the network / IP from the list of allowed networks?

No Yes

Add allowed network / IP

Do you really want to Add the network / IP to the list of allowed networks?

No Yes

Unban IP

Do you really want to unban the IP ?

No Yes

Ban IP

Do you really want to ban the IP ?

No Yes

Execute shell command


            
Close Clear Execute

Unsaved Changessave

You have unsaved changes in the current file. Please save the changes or close the file before opening a new one.

Abort Close file Save changes

New Foldercreate_new_folder


Cancel OK

New Filenote_add


Cancel OK

New Branch

Cancel OK

Network status

$listening_address

$hass_api_address

Modifying the following lists is not persistent. To statically control access please use the configuration file.



      Cancel

      HASS Configurator

      Version: $current

      Web-based file editor designed to modify configuration files of Home Assistant or other textual files. Use at your own risk.

      Published under the MIT license

      Developed by:

      • Contact Person Daniel Perna
      • Contact Person JT Martinez
      • Contact Person AtoxIO
      • Contact Person Martin Treml
      • Contact Person Sytone
      • Contact Person Dima Goltsman

      Libraries used:

      Ace Editor

      Materialize

      JQuery

      GitPython

      js-yaml

      OK
      OK

      edit
      • undo
      • redo
      • format_indent_increase
      • format_indent_decrease
      • all_out
        • note_add create_new_folder file_upload
          note_add create_new_folder file_upload
      • arrow_back
          • arrow_drop_downBranch: add
          • Editor Settings
          • Keyboard Shortcuts

            Save Settings Locally

            Ace Editor 1.2.9